Houston Rockets Make Waves with Bold Moves

The Houston Rockets have transformed into a formidable force in the NBA, showcasing a blend of tenacity and skill that has quickly elevated them among the league’s elite teams. Known for their relentless defense, fluid ball movement, and impressive rebounding, the Rockets have established a reputation that is hard to ignore. They lead the league in both offensive rebounds and second-chance points, demonstrating a commitment to maximizing every possession.

A New Era of Transformation

This current iteration of the Rockets bears little resemblance to the team of just three years ago. The transition from the previous regime was not merely a change of personnel; it was a complete overhaul. Under the new leadership, the team initially found itself wandering without direction, struggling with a lack of guidance, young talent, and draft capital. It was a situation that many would describe as a bare cupboard, forcing the Rockets into a rebuilding phase.

Rebuilding in the NBA is a delicate endeavor. The draft can be unpredictable, and the notion of a “can’t-miss” prospect often proves to be a mirage. The Charlotte Hornets exemplify this struggle, having spent over two decades trying to rebuild while consistently drafting high. The road is fraught with challenges, as bad organizations often find themselves in a relentless cycle of failure. However, the Rockets managed to navigate this tumultuous period and emerge stronger.

Recognition for Front Office Excellence

Despite enduring a rough stretch—posting a dismal record of 59-177 from 2020 to 2023—the Rockets have positioned themselves for a brighter future. Their efforts have not gone unnoticed; The Athletic recently ranked their front office as the third-best in the NBA. This recognition is a testament to the strategic decisions made by the organization’s leadership.

One of the most significant moves was the trade for superstar Kevin Durant, a transaction that signaled the Rockets’ intent to compete at the highest level. Sam Amick of The Athletic noted that this bold decision reflected a belief that the time had come to seize the moment. Importantly, the Rockets were able to acquire Durant, along with a key player like Clint Capela, without depleting their roster or sacrificing their future.

The trade involved Jalen Green and Dillon Brooks, among others, showcasing the Rockets’ willingness to make calculated risks to enhance their competitiveness. This approach underscores a commitment to building a team that not only looks to win now but also maintains the potential for sustained success in the years to come.
